Why is friendship with Jesus important for Christians?

Friendship with Jesus is vital because He guides, teaches, and lays down His life for His friends (John 15:15).

The importance of being a friend of Jesus is underscored in John 15:15, where He indicates that He shares His secrets and teachings with those He considers friends. This relationship transforms the dynamic from mere servitude to intimate fellowship. As His friends, we are called to emulate His love and serve others, reflecting His character in our lives. Additionally, this friendship assures us of His constant presence, support in times of trouble (Proverbs 18:24), and the promise that He will never leave us or forsake us. It encourages us to remain in Him, allowing our faith to deepen and produce fruit in our lives (John 15:5).
Scripture References: John 15:15, Proverbs 18:24, John 15:5
